如何部署程序到tomcat服务器
-
部署程序到Tomcat服务器的步骤如下:
-
确保已安装并配置好Tomcat服务器。如果尚未安装Tomcat,可以从官方网站(http://tomcat.apache.org)下载最新的Tomcat版本,并按照官方文档进行安装和配置。
-
打开Tomcat服务器的安装目录,在webapps文件夹下新建一个文件夹,用于存放你的Web应用程序。可以根据需要给这个文件夹取一个有意义的名字,比如"myapp"。
-
将你的Web应用程序打包成WAR文件。WAR(Web Application Archive)是一种特殊的压缩文件格式,用于打包Web应用程序的文件和目录结构。你可以使用Maven或者其他打包工具将你的程序打包成WAR文件。
-
将打包好的WAR文件复制到步骤2创建的文件夹中。确保将WAR文件的名称保持不变,即如果你的WAR文件名为"myapp.war",则复制到文件夹中后的文件名也应为"myapp.war"。
-
启动Tomcat服务器。可以通过执行Tomcat安装目录下的bin目录中的startup.bat(Windows)或startup.sh(Linux)脚本来启动Tomcat。
-
部署完成后,打开浏览器,并访问"http://localhost:8080/myapp",其中"myapp"是你在步骤2中创建的文件夹的名称。如果一切正常,你应该能够看到你的Web应用程序的首页。
总结:部署程序到Tomcat服务器的步骤包括安装和配置Tomcat服务器、创建一个文件夹用于存放Web应用程序、将打包好的WAR文件复制到该文件夹中,并启动Tomcat服务器。通过浏览器访问"http://localhost:8080/你的应用程序名"来验证部署是否成功。
1年前 -
-
部署程序到Tomcat服务器是一项重要的任务,以下是一个详细的步骤指南,以帮助您完成这个过程。
-
下载并安装Tomcat服务器:首先,访问Apache Tomcat的官方网站,下载适用于您操作系统的Tomcat版本。安装程序会帮助您完成安装过程,并为您设置Tomcat服务器的基本配置。
-
配置Tomcat服务器:一旦Tomcat服务器安装完毕,您需要对其进行一些配置。主要的配置文件是
server.xml,位于Tomcat安装目录的conf文件夹中。您可以使用文本编辑器打开该文件,并根据需要进行修改。其中一些重要的配置选项包括端口号、连接器配置、虚拟主机等。 -
创建Web应用程序:在将Web应用程序部署到Tomcat服务器之前,您需要先创建一个Web应用程序。这可以基于Java的Servlet、JSP、Spring等技术来构建。确保您的应用程序具有适当的目录结构和必需的配置文件(例如
web.xml)。将应用程序打包成WAR文件(Web存档),以便后续部署到Tomcat服务器。 -
部署Web应用程序:将WAR文件复制到Tomcat服务器的
webapps文件夹中。一旦您将WAR文件放入该文件夹中,Tomcat服务器会自动解压并部署Web应用程序。Tomcat会为每个部署的应用程序创建一个与WAR文件同名的文件夹,并将应用程序的内容解压到该文件夹中。 -
启动Tomcat服务器:现在,您可以启动Tomcat服务器,并在Web浏览器中访问您的Web应用程序。打开命令行窗口(或终端),导航到Tomcat安装目录的
bin文件夹,并执行以下命令来启动Tomcat服务器:./catalina.sh start(Linux/Mac)或者catalina.bat start(Windows)。一旦服务器启动,您可以通过访问http://localhost:8080/来验证Tomcat服务器是否成功运行。
总结:
部署程序到Tomcat服务器需要执行一系列的步骤,包括下载并安装Tomcat服务器,配置服务器,创建Web应用程序,部署应用程序,以及启动Tomcat服务器。跟随上述步骤,您将能够成功部署程序到Tomcat服务器,并在浏览器中访问您的Web应用程序。1年前 -
-
部署程序到Tomcat服务器的步骤如下:
第一步:准备环境
- 确保已经安装了Java开发环境(JDK)和Tomcat服务器。
- 确认Tomcat服务器已经正确配置并且启动。
第二步:打包程序
- 将程序源代码编译成可执行的程序文件(比如WAR或者JAR文件),并将其放在一个指定的目录下。
第三步:配置Tomcat服务器
- 找到Tomcat服务器的安装目录,进入到该目录的conf文件夹下。
- 打开server.xml文件,并找到对应的
<Host>标签(通常是localhost或者127.0.0.1)。 - 在
<Host>标签下,找到<Context>标签,并添加一个新的<Context>标签。 - 在新的
<Context>标签中,配置path和docBase属性。- path属性设置了访问该程序的URL路径,比如/path。
- docBase属性设置了程序包的路径,指向之前编译打包好的程序文件的位置,比如D:\path\demo.war。
第四步:部署程序
- 将打包好的程序文件(比如demo.war)复制到Tomcat服务器的webapps目录下。
- 运行Tomcat服务器,等待其自动解压和部署程序。
- 在浏览器中访问后台地址:http://localhost:8080/path,其中8080是Tomcat服务器的端口号,path是之前配置的path属性的值。
- 如果一切正常,应该能够看到程序的运行结果。
补充说明:
- 如果程序文件已经被解压到webapps目录下的文件夹中,可以跳过第四步的复制操作。
- 如果要修改已经部署好的程序,可以直接替换webapps目录下对应的文件或文件夹。Tomcat服务器会自动检测变化并重新部署程序。
- 如果部署的程序需要依赖外部的库文件,可以将这些库文件放置在Tomcat服务器的lib目录下。
1年前